Foxconn casts doubt on Sharp deal

By Bloomberg | China Daily | Updated: 2016-02-26 07:45

Electronics company refuses to finalize agreement due to 'new material'

Just hours after winning a board vote to take control of Japanese electronics maker Sharp Corp, Foxconn Technology Group said in a surprise reversal that it would postpone signing a definitive agreement because of "new material information."

Under an agreement announced by Sharp, Foxconn would control 65.9 percent of Sharp after buying new shares at 118 yen ($1.05) apiece, or 32 percent less than Wednesday's closing price. The company said it won't finalize a deal until the situation with the new information is resolved.
